Garden Design & Landscaping Cost in Glasgow

08 Aug 2026

  • Basic tidy-up: £1,050-£3,200
  • Mid-range redesign: £3,700-£9,000
  • Full landscaping: £9,000-£18,000 upwards

Private gardens are mostly a feature of Glasgow's house stock - Bearsden, Newton Mearns, and the more suburban parts of the Southside - rather than the tenement flats that make up most of the inner city, where residents more commonly share a communal back court rather than a private garden.

Communal back courts

Where a tenement does have a shared back court, any significant landscaping work typically needs agreement from the other owners in the block, since the space is common property under the Tenements (Scotland) Act 2004 - a genuinely different starting point from a private garden project.

What drives the price for house gardens

Access without a side gate adds labour time, as in any city. Mature trees are sometimes protected - worth checking with the council before any design involving removal.

Frequently asked questions

How much does garden landscaping cost in Glasgow?

A basic tidy-up runs £1,050-£3,200, a mid-range redesign £3,700-£9,000, and full landscaping £9,000-£18,000 upwards, mainly relevant to the city's house stock.

Do Glasgow tenement flats have private gardens?

Rarely - most share a communal back court instead, and that space is common property under the Tenements (Scotland) Act 2004, so significant landscaping needs agreement from other owners.
